#2650de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#2650de is composed of 14.9% red, 31.4% green and 87.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 82.9% cyan, 64% magenta, 0% yellow and 12.9% black. It has a hue angle of 226.3 degrees, a saturation of 73.6% and a lightness of 51%. #2650de color hex could be obtained by blending #4ca0ff with #0000bd. Closest websafe color is: #3366cc.

Shades and Tints of #2650de
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010104 is the darkest color, while #f2f5fd is the lightest one.

Tones of #2650de
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7d7f87 is the less saturated color, while #0940fb is the most saturated one.
